Deep learning has emerged as a transformative powerhouse in the field of artificial intelligence. It empowers computers to learn from vast amounts of data, uncovering intricate patterns and insights that were previously inaccessible. Picture a system capable of recognizing images, converting languages, and even generating creative content — these are just a few of the remarkable capabilities unlocked by deep learning.
To demystify this fascinating field, let's explore its fundamental concepts. At its core, deep learning involves cognitive networks, which are inspired by the structure of the human brain. These networks consist of interconnected neurons that process information in a sequential manner.
As data flows through these networks, each node transforms the input signal, gradually refining its representation. This iterative procedure allows deep learning models to adapt and improve their performance over time.
Conditioning a deep learning model involves feeding it massive datasets and adjusting the connections between nodes based on the accuracy of its predictions. Through this rigorous process, the model gains the ability to generalize its knowledge to new, unseen data.
Deep learning has already revolutionized a wide range of fields, from medicine and business to entertainment. As research continues to advance, we can expect even more revolutionary applications in the years to come.
